Free Food Scheme: MEPs call for swift action to ensure proper funding

Plenary Session Social policy 28-09-2011 - 10:04
 

The Council and Commission must take prompt action to avert a sharp cutback in funding of the Free Food scheme, an EU programme for the needy with more than 13 million beneficiaries, said MEPs across the board in today's debate with Commissioner Dacian Cioloş and Polish Minister Marek Sawicki.


MEPs also denounced the six Member States which are blocking debate in the Council on ways to save the scheme and asked the Polish Presidency to help to end the impasse.
